Leonard Michaels

An American writer of short stories, essays, and novels, he is known for such works as Going Places and I Would Have Saved Them If I Could. Leonard Michaels was born on January 2, 1933, in New York. His novel, The Men’s Club, was made into a film featuring Harvey Keitel. He graduated from New York University and subsequently received a Ph.D. in English literature from the University of Michigan. He later taught English at the University of California, Berkeley.

He was the New York-born son of a Jewish-Polish immigrant father. He was married three times: to Sylvia Bloch, Katharine Ogden, and Brenda Hillman. His son Jessie Michaels is a singer. He has not shared his parent’s names.
